STM32F413/423中文参考手册:寄存器详细描述

需积分: 9 33 下载量 59 浏览量 更新于2024-07-17 收藏 15.46MB PDF 举报
"RM0430--STM32F413/423寄存器描述 中文,STM32F413/423中文参考手册,涵盖所有寄存器的详细中文描述,适用于嵌入式硬件开发,涉及STM32微控制器和ARM Cortex-M4内核。" STM32F413/423是基于ARM Cortex-M4内核的32位高级微控制器,具备浮点单元(FPU),适合于各种嵌入式应用。这些微控制器系列的不同产品拥有不同的内存大小、封装形式和外设选项,详细的技术参数可在对应的数据手册中找到。 STM32F413/423的系统架构包括多条总线,如I总线、D总线、S总线、DMA存储器总线和DMA外设总线,它们构成了复杂的通信网络。总线矩阵和AHB/APB总线桥则允许高效的处理器与外设之间的数据传输。存储器组织结构中,嵌入式SRAM和Flash是重要的组成部分,其中Flash提供了程序存储空间,而SRAM则作为工作内存。 嵌入式Flash接口是STM32F413/423的重要特性,它支持快速读取、擦除和编程操作。通过自适应实时存储器加速器(ART Accelerator)可以实现高速的执行速度,即使在低CPU时钟频率下也能保持高性能。擦除和编程操作涉及到特定的寄存器解锁和并行位处理,确保了数据安全性和编程效率。 该参考手册中的寄存器描述部分,对每个外设的控制和状态寄存器进行了详细解读,这对于开发者理解和控制微控制器的行为至关重要。开发者可以通过这些中文描述更好地理解和利用STM32F413/423的众多功能,如定时器、串口、GPIO、ADC、DAC、PWM、USB、CAN、SPI、I2C等,从而实现各种复杂的应用设计。 STM32F413/423的开发还涉及到编程工具和固件库,例如HAL(Hardware Abstraction Layer)库和LL(Low-Layer)库,这些库函数提供了丰富的API,简化了软件开发过程,使得开发者能更专注于应用逻辑,而不是底层硬件细节。 RM0430中文参考手册为STM32F413/423的使用者提供了全面的资料,涵盖了从系统架构到寄存器操作的各个方面,是进行STM32单片机开发不可或缺的参考资料。通过深入理解并应用手册中的知识,开发者能够高效地开发出满足需求的嵌入式系统。